Use “must” to show that you think something is probably true.
Use “might” or “could” to show that you think something is possibly true.
Use “can’t” to show that you are almost sure something is not true.

辨析:must 与have to
must “必须”,表示主观上认为有义务,有必要。
have to “不得不”,着重表示客观上的需要。don’t have to表示“不必”。

词(组) 用法
attend 指“出席(会议、婚礼、典礼等);到场;上 (课)”等,侧重指去看或听,但自己不一定起积极作用。
join 侧重指加入某党派、团体、组织、人群等,并成为其中一员,相当于 become a member of。
join in 多指参加小规模的活动,如“球赛、游戏” 等,常用于日常口语。
take part in 指参加某一活动并在其中起积极作用。 take an active part in 表示“积极参加”。
